Former President Donald Trump is leading Vice President Kamala Harris nationally by three points in a two-way race, according to a recent survey.
A Wall Street Journal survey, conducted between October 19-22, 2024, which surveyed 1,500 registered voters, found that in a two-way race, Trump received 49 percent of support, while Harris received 46 percent of support, according to Fox News.
